Targets beginning to intermediate Excel users seeking real-world examples of how they can use Excel's powerful built-in functionsShows readers how to use Excel functions in formulas to help them decide between buying and leasing a car, calculate mortgage costs, compute grades, evaluate investment performance, figure college expenses, and moreGives explanations and examples of real-world situationsProvides an abbreviated discussion of an additional 200 functionsExcel commands nearly 90 percent of the market for spreadsheet applications; although this book is written for Excel 2003, the functions described are in earlier versions as well «
